Software Engineer
Having conducted several graduate and junior developer mentoring experiences now, I thought I'd take a moment to review them, share my approach, and...
Building software is something I know well at this point, but I wanted to explore the modern necessities which accompany an application and enable it...
Having built up a design for the application, and mocked up the UI, it was time to write some code to bring those elements to life. Here's a brief...
Having recently migrated from a Linux/macOS based workplace to a Windows-based one, I found one thing to be lacking - a lightweight Git prompt for all...
Last time , we covered the basics of the ever-popular distributed version control system, Git - enough to get started using it alone, locally. This...
Version control isn't a new concept to most coders - heck, certainly not the industry. In general, it has long been the backbone of many aspects of...